The MP for North Antrim has apologised for retweeting a comment from Katie Hopkins.
The tweet read - "March 2018. London has a higher murder rate than New York... and Ramadan's not yet begun."
Ian Paisley has since deleted the comment from his Twitter account, and tweeted an apology last night saying no harm was intended.
Mea culpa earlier today I glanced at a tweet & rt about # of murders in London. Didn't take cognisance of Ramadan ref. Once brought to my attention immediately deleted. Apologise profusely for offence caused. https://t.co/MGneSXHuMF
— Ian Paisley MP (@ianpaisleymp) April 2, 2018
